What is the IELTS?

The IELTS is jointly handled by the British Council, IDP: IELTS Australia, and Cambridge Assessment English. It is developed to assess the language efficiency of non-native English speakers who want to study, work, or reside in English-speaking nations. The test is readily available in two formats: Academic and General Training.

The IELTS Test Structure

The IELTS test is divided into four areas, each created to evaluate different elements of language proficiency:

  1. Listening (30 minutes): Candidates listen to 4 recorded texts and address concerns based upon what they hear. The texts range from a discussion in between 2 individuals to a monologue on an academic subject.
  2. Reading (60 minutes): The Academic version includes three long texts of increasing problem, while the General Training variation consists of texts from books, publications, papers, and company handbooks.
  3. Writing (60 minutes): The Academic variation needs prospects to write a 150-word report explaining a graph, table, or diagram, followed by a 250-word essay. The General Training version consists of a letter and a 250-word essay.
  4. Speaking (11-14 minutes): This section is an in person interview with an inspector. It includes a conversation about familiar subjects, a brief speech, and a conversation.

Why is the IELTS Important?

The IELTS is acknowledged by over 10,000 companies worldwide, consisting of universities, companies, professional bodies, and migration authorities. A good IELTS score can open doors to:

  • University Admissions: Many universities require a minimum IELTS score for admission to their programs.
  • Work Opportunities: Employers in English-speaking nations frequently require a specific level of English proficiency, which the IELTS can show.

How to Avoid IELTS Scams

To avoid coming down with IELTS scams, it is important to follow these standards:

  • Official Channels: Always register for the IELTS through authorities channels, such as the British Council, IDP: IELTS Australia, or Cambridge Assessment English.
  • Research study: Verify the authenticity of any company or individual offering IELTS preparation or registration services.
  • Be Wary of Promises: If an offer seems too good to be true, it most likely is. Nobody can ensure a specific score or offer a shortcut to passing the test.
  • Report Suspicious Activity: If you stumble upon a fraud, report it to the relevant authorities and the main IELTS organizations.

Q: What is the IELTS band score?

A: The IELTS band score varies from 0 to 9, with 9 being the greatest. Each area of the test (Listening, Reading, Writing, and Speaking) is scored independently, and the overall band score is the average of the four area scores.
